The aftermath ending It’s decidedly comical, but after the series of sinister events unfolding on the premises of the house, we don’t think it’s safe for Kevin or Natalie to stay in the house any longer.Īlso, in the final shot, the door closes on its own, indicating a supernatural presence. They say goodbye to the crime scene showing their middle finger and the movie reaches the scheduled end. Therefore, the purpose of the film sees the couple moving out of the house. But now, with Natalie’s business finally taking off, we believe they have no financial problems paying the mortgage. Previously, we had seen Natalie asking Kevin to sell that damn house and move in, but Kevin turned her down saying they were under significant financial stress. We see that the couple now have a new dog. After the devastating encounter with Otto, Natalie is still a bit in shock. The epilogue begins with a one-month time jump. Natalie stabs him in the neck with a pair of scissors, and as the police rush out of the house in the next shot, we feel like Otto is dead. Otto fights Kevin, but Natalie distracts his attention.Īs he goes downstairs to take care of Natalie, Kevin sneaks up behind him and gives Otto some of his own medicine. When Otto ventures out in search of Kevin, Natalie has time to free herself from her shackles. Natalie asks Otto to attack Kevin, promising that they can be together once the action is done. Natalie calms Otto with seductive words, but when Otto sees Kevin enter the house, we feel that Kevin’s life is in danger. Erin apparently betrayed him by keeping him locked in the dungeon, which explains his current neurotic state. We understand that Otto is Erin’s secret lover, who remains in a dungeon under the house, allegedly arranged by Erin. This is Otto, the person who saw Natalie while she was sleeping and poisoned Kevin and the dog. For a while we think Natalie is hallucinating, but only later in the story do we find out that this guy exists. The police arrest Robert, but the mystery doesn’t end there. Natalie is attacked by one Travis Murray, and the police have evidence that Robert Sorrentino circulated a post describing Natalie as a lonely wife with BDSM fetishes. Things got worse after Odi was sprayed with a poisonous substance.Īfter Odi, Kevin falls ill from the same substance and, from talking to the doctor, Natalie knows that the substance is Nerium, a poisonous flower that commonly grows in gardens. Robert’s words of contempt for Natalie are a not-so-subtle threat, and we think Robert may have something to do with the mysterious events in the house. However, Claudia still seems to believe that Jay liked Erin too much.Īs she leaves the house, Natalie confronts Robert. Erin apparently had an affair with someone whose identity is shrouded in mystery. Jay was not loyal to Erin and Erin considered revenge. Thanks to Claudia, Natalie learns that the previous owners of the house were Jay, Claudia’s brother, and his wife, Erin. Scared and paranoid, Natalie goes to see Claudia to learn more about the bloody history of the house. If you have any questions about the aftermath ending, keep reading! Aftermath ending explained Strange things start to happen almost immediately, in keeping with classic haunted house tropes, like your dog Odi barking in front of an empty closet and objects disappearing and reappearing elsewhere. It doesn’t seem like a promising start to a new beginning and it turns out quickly after Natalie and Kevin move in. They only know this house because Kevin works as a crime scene cleaner and recently worked there after a gruesome murder-suicide involving former residents.
